Output 81db233a1e26a95866fed391df68424b6ab127f2faf10e551f533cb94dade899:1

value
191948820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71bb29ae10e0e174f6244597032d011bfe4bec23 OP_EQUAL
address
3C4NVXA83AVJb9h6QJw1AeXo6hxzkn6RUK
transaction
81db233a1e26a95866fed391df68424b6ab127f2faf10e551f533cb94dade899
spent
true